⚡️ 🚫 Bahraini Foreign Minister: We are submitting a draft resolution to the UN Security Council concerning the security of maritime navigation in the Arabian Gulf. Gulf states are the primary source of energy flow to the world, making the Strait of Hormuz a shared international responsibility. If the Security Council allows the Strait of Hormuz to remain closed today, the same will happen with other straits later. #Iran's insistence on disrupting international navigation is not an emergency but rather part of a documented negative approach. The proposed draft resolution does not create a new reality but rather constitutes a serious response to repeated aggressive Iranian behavior.




🚨 New details from the rescue of the weapons systems officer in Iran: -As the special forces approached "go" time to get him off the mountain, several things happened. Centcom and JSOC received some messages from him. One was a four-digit number. "We said, 'What is he talking about?'" The team asked the person with the officer's radio a question about his dad only the officer would know. -For hours, US bombers had been pounding Iranian targets, including one bunker with 50 IRGC leaders in it, and another bunker sheltering a commander. -After Hegseth greenlit the second rescue operation, he told those with him he wanted to read something he thought reflected what the officer was going through. It was from Exodus. -The team was in touch with the weapons systems officer’s wife. They read her in on a deception operation CIA and Centcom were running. -Trump's team agonized over the clock, watching enemy forces nearing the mountain. Five kilometers away. Three kilometers away.
